20 Minutes of Teaching Brilliance (On the Road with Trust-Based Observations) - Creating a Supportive Learning Environment for Neurodivergent Students with Thaint Elliot

Creating a Supportive Learning Environment for Neurodivergent Students with Thaint Elliot

04/12/25 • 30 min

20 Minutes of Teaching Brilliance (On the Road with Trust-Based Observations)

In this episode, Craig speaks with Thaint Elliot, a dedicated reading interventionist, about her experiences and methodologies in creating a supportive and efficient learning environment for neurodivergent students. They also delve into broader educational challenges and potential solutions for public school systems.
